Transaction 7fef08a213cc77695aa80f9ec771df1000996c9656d690f3ecd9f80a1056043d

2 Input
2 Outputs
  • 7fef08a213cc77695aa80f9ec771df1000996c9656d690f3ecd9f80a1056043d:0
  • value  817670
    address  1PkBGgbYjxL27facVgei2xn4Q7EWTDc3za
  • 7fef08a213cc77695aa80f9ec771df1000996c9656d690f3ecd9f80a1056043d:1
  • value  101870
    address  3MPu4quepazY7u7nEvpHH8weLR1gCJTn6p